Derek Hough Announced as New 'Extra' Host

Derek Hough takes over as host of Extra for Season 32, featuring new segments, digital content, and a fresh set in a show cleared in over 95% of U.S. markets.

  • The syndicated show Extra appoints Derek Hough as host for Season 32 beginning September 8, replacing Billy Bush.
  • Earlier this year, showrunner Jeremy Spiegel developed a reimagined season with new segments built around Hough, following Billy Bush's exit and Theresa Coffino's departure.
  • Derek Hough joins with four Emmys and as a New York Times bestselling author, enhancing Extra's nationally cleared Season 32.
  • Derek Hough will join senior correspondent Mona Kosar Abdi and longtime correspondent Terri Seymour, and he will continue as a judge on Dancing With the Stars Season 34.
  • Produced by Telepictures, a Warner Bros. Television Group company, Extra's 2025-26 season features a new set, graphics, segments around Hough, and original digital content, with distribution by Warner Bros. Discovery Content Sales.
